Aspen Roller vs Daisy case-bearer
Ancylis laetana compared with Coleophora ramosella
Key Differences
- Aspen Roller is Least Concern while Daisy case-bearer is Vulnerable.
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Aspen Roller | Daisy case-bearer |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class same | Insecta (Insects)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order same |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Tortricidae | Coleophoridae |
| Genus | Ancylis | Coleophora |
| Species | Ancylis laetana | Coleophora ramosella |
Evolutionary Relationship
Aspen Roller and Daisy case-bearer share a common ancestor at the Order level: Lepidoptera. (Butterflies & Moths)
